Após algumas horas de viagem, de Porto Alegre (RS) a Brasília (DF), finalmente cheguei ao meu destino e, assim como o João de Santo Cristo, fiquei “bestificado” com a cidade. Também fiquei um pouco receoso, claro, já que era primeira viagem pela Umbler que fazia sozinho. Meu rumo: Darkmira Tour PHP 2017.
Primeiro dia: 27 de maio
Fui em direção à Universidade Católica de Brasília (UCB), com camisetas, adesivos e uma agenda cheia de palestras. O Darkmira Tour PHP é um evento muito organizado, do cadastramento ao roteiro de talks – essa é a melhor maneira de descrevê-lo. Aliás, foi justamente no cadastramento que conheci o Feitoza (@FeitozaAle), da comunidade PHP com Rapadura. De cara já me identificou como o “rapaz da Umbler”, me recebeu de braços abertos e me contou um pouco da experiência sobre essa supercomunidade PHP do nordeste e sobre eventos como o PHPeste.
Um de nossos amigos, o @simonardejr, tinha uma missão: encontrar o representante da Umbler no evento para ganhar a camiseta do Umblerito Star Wars. O que não foi uma missão difícil porque, em 20 minutos de evento, ele apareceu e me pediu a camiseta!
Achei!! Hahahaha!! Obrigado pela camisa!! #DarkMiraTour #Umbler @umbler pic.twitter.com/00zB8CxHNZ
— Simonarde Jr. (@simonardejr) May 27, 2017
E, lá fui eu em direção ao auditório para a primeira palestra do dia: An ElePHPant Life do Damien Seguy, CTO da Exakat LTD. Damien é o criador da famosa pelúcia PHP e nos contou como foi o início do projeto, toda dificuldade que teve e como conseguiu chegar onde está hoje. Uma palestra muito engraçada, com ótimas histórias. É claro que não me aguentei e fui conversar com ele. Ao me ver com a camiseta da Umbler, com o Umblerito montado no ElePHPant, ele disse: “Wow! Cool this shirt!”. Que bom que gostou, porque ia justamente presentá-lo com uma.
Uma publicação compartilhada por Umbler (@instaumbler) em
Em seguida, fui para a palestra do Jack Makiyama, GIT: Do primeiro commit ao pull request. Uma palestra voltada a profissionais de T.I que ainda não usam o versionamento dos seus projetos e apostam no nosso velho amigo FTP. Mostrou os prós em usar o Git para conseguir trabalhar com times grandes e também como contribuir com os projetos da comunidade.
Logo depois foi a vez do nosso amigo Raphael Almeida e sua palestra de segurança: Anatomia de um Ataque. Reforçou que nossas aplicações são atacadas constantemente e que, mesmo um site pequeno, não está livre de ser escaneado e atacado. Falou da importância de desenvolver sempre pensando na segurança e de sempre fazer Pentests na aplicação para garantir a integridade. Ao final da palestra fui conversar com ele e claro que ele também ganhou uma camiseta da Umbler! 😀
No #DarkmiraTour o @raph_almeida falando sobre anatomia de um ataque @DarkmiraTour #PHP pic.twitter.com/EzQIEXdu5k
— Umbler (@umbler) May 27, 2017
Depois foi a vez do grande Rodrigo Wanderley, ou como muitos conhecem, @pokemaobr. Sua palestra foi: Criando sua Stack de Deploy PHP com Git, Jenkins e Ansible. Mostrou os problemas que surgem ao fazer vários deploys durante o dia (e seus versionamentos) e como resolveu isso de uma forma criativa, estruturada e segura. Claro que ele não deixou o bom humor de lado e, entre uma explicação e outra, soltava aquelas piadas que só os devs conhecem.
Palestra do @pokemaobr no #DarkmiraTour
criando sua stack de deploy #PHP com #git, #jenkins e #ansible pic.twitter.com/r5w9d8KGgj— Umbler (@umbler) May 27, 2017
Já Wellington Silva falou de Docker Swarm vs. Kubernets. Como o nosso Node.JS da Umbler rodará em Docker, claro que não poderia perder essa palestra. Ele falou dos conceitos dos dois orquestradores e fez um overview falando das vantagens e desvantagens em usar um ou outro. Como Wellington é um grande amigo da Umbler, fui trocar uma ideia com ele sobre as vantagens e os benefícios que o Docker traz para os desenvolvedores, tanto em ambiente de homologação quanto em ambiente de produção. Disso, só podia sair coisa boa!
No @DarkmiraTour, @_wsilva falando sobre Docker Swarm vs Kubernets #DarkmiraTour #PHP pic.twitter.com/gs7s166Wvq
— Umbler (@umbler) May 27, 2017
Fim do primeiro ato dia do evento.
Segundo dia: 28 de maio
No domingo, mais um dia de evento. E, nesse dia, o fluxo de pessoas na universidade era enorme, tudo em razão do vestibular. Muita gente jovem, novos talentos na área de tecnologia. Tanta movimentação que, claro, me perdi dentro do campus. Tive a sorte de encontrar uma alma generosa que me deu uma carona lá dentro mesmo e me largou no prédio certo.
Ainda bem que consegui chegar em tempo de assistir o Bruno Neves e sua palestra “Do Rest ao GraphQL com PHP”, uma alternativa poderosa na construção de API’s que foi desenvolvida pelo Facebook. Bruno fez um overview e nos ensinou a desenvolver uma API com GraphQL. Nos alertou das desvantagens que existem em usar essa tecnologia e, certamente, ajudou muitos devs que procuravam uma solução destas, mas ainda não conheciam essa tecnologia.
Segundo dia do @DarkmiraTour começou com @brunodasneves falando sobre Do REST ao GraphQL com #PHP #DarkmiraTour pic.twitter.com/pLrRCCZnLI
— Umbler (@umbler) May 28, 2017
Conhecemos a Juliana Chahoud, uma mulher superinteligente que nos mostrou Programação Reativa Funcional e Extensões para PHP, uma nova forma de pensar, um novo paradigma no desenvolvimento. Nos deu excelentes exemplos de aplicação de RxPHP. Ao final da palestra, não podia deixar de conversar com ela. Falamos bastante sobre tecnologia e da importância da presença de mulheres na área de T.I. Também não faltou aquela camiseta de presente!
Uma publicação compartilhada por Umbler (@instaumbler) em
Marcelo Neres Cabral mediou o talk “Existe Vida Além da Fábrica?” junto dos seus amigos Felipe Moura e Lucas Campelo. Deu o seu relato sobre o modelo tradicional de fábrica de software e como melhorar a qualidade do trabalho e de vida usando métodos como Scrum e Kanban. Para Cabral, o investimento em pessoas e em tecnologia é a chave para melhorar a entrega dos times – algo que conversa com o que acreditamos na Umbler!
Após o debate, tivemos uma conversa muito bacana com os representantes das comunidades de PHP e fiz amizade com o pessoal do PHPSPSantos (@phpspsantos), PHP com Rapadura (@phpcomrapadura) e PHPDF (@phpdf_). Muita gente inteligente e interessada nos mesmos assuntos que nós.
Para fechar o evento, a última palestra do dia foi com o Vinicius Feitosa da Silva da comunidade do PHPDF, que falou sobre Motivação x Profissional Eficaz. Ótimos temas para fechar com chave de ouro: inteligência emocional e a motivação em ser um profissional melhor, não tecnicamente, mas pessoalmente.
Palestra Motivação vs Profissional Eficaz do Vinicius Feitosa, do @phpdf_ #DarkmiraTour #php pic.twitter.com/Y5XNVGPMJv
— Umbler (@umbler) May 28, 2017
Por fim, foram sorteados dois ElePHPants (mas, infelizmente, não ganhei!). O que ganhei foram grandes amigos que ficaram em Brasília, e outros que foram para suas casas em Fortaleza, São Paulo e outros locais. Essa troca de energia entre profissionais é o que nos faz crescer e saber que estamos no caminho certo. Seja com amizades, parcerias ou apenas um feedback.